SCPI updates and fixes for v4.8

1. Adds support for device power state management using generic power
   domains and runtime PM

2. Other minor/miscellaneous fixes to the driver

* tag 'scpi-updates-4.8' of git://git.kernel.org/pub/scm/linux/kernel/git/sudeep.holla/linux:
  firmware: scpi: add device power domain support using genpd
  Documentation: add DT bindings for ARM SCPI power domains
  firmware: arm_scpi: add support for device power state management
  firmware: arm_scpi: make it depend on MAILBOX instead of ARM_MHU
  firmware: arm_scpi: mark scpi_get_sensor_value as static
  firmware: arm_scpi: remove dvfs_get packed structure

+Power domain bindings for the power domains based on SCPI Message Protocol
+------------------------------------------------------------
+
+This binding uses the generic power domain binding[4].
+
+PM domain providers
+===================
+
+Required properties:
+ - #power-domain-cells : Should be 1. Contains the device or the power
+                        domain ID value used by SCPI commands.
+ - num-domains: Total number of power domains provided by SCPI. This is
+               needed as the SCPI message protocol lacks a mechanism to
+               query this information at runtime.
+
+PM domain consumers
+===================
+
+Required properties:
+ - power-domains : A phandle and PM domain specifier as defined by bindings of
+                   the power controller specified by phandle.
+

+/*
+ * SCPI Generic power domain support.
+ *
+ * Copyright (C) 2016 ARM Ltd.
+ *
+ * This program is free software; you can redistribute it and/or modify it
+ * under the terms and conditions of the GNU General Public License,
+ * version 2, as published by the Free Software Foundation.
+ *
+ * This program is distributed in the hope it will be useful, but WITHOUT
+ * ANY WARRANTY; without even the implied warranty of MERCHANTABILITY or
+ * FITNESS FOR A PARTICULAR PURPOSE. See the GNU General Public License for
+ * more details.
+ *
+ * You should have received a copy of the GNU General Public License along
+ * with this program. If not, see <http://www.gnu.org/licenses/>.
+ */
+
+#include <linux/err.h>
+#include <linux/io.h>
+#include <linux/module.h>
+#include <linux/of_platform.h>
+#include <linux/pm_domain.h>
+#include <linux/scpi_protocol.h>
+
+struct scpi_pm_domain {
+       struct generic_pm_domain genpd;
+       struct scpi_ops *ops;
+       u32 domain;
+       char name[30];
+};
+
+/*
+ * These device power state values are not well-defined in the specification.
+ * In case, different implementations use different values, we can make these
+ * specific to compatibles rather than getting these values from device tree.
+ */
+enum scpi_power_domain_state {
+       SCPI_PD_STATE_ON = 0,
+       SCPI_PD_STATE_OFF = 3,
+};
+
+#define to_scpi_pd(gpd) container_of(gpd, struct scpi_pm_domain, genpd)
+
+static int scpi_pd_power(struct scpi_pm_domain *pd, bool power_on)
+{
+       int ret;
+       enum scpi_power_domain_state state;
+
+       if (power_on)
+               state = SCPI_PD_STATE_ON;
+       else
+               state = SCPI_PD_STATE_OFF;
+
+       ret = pd->ops->device_set_power_state(pd->domain, state);
+       if (ret)
+               return ret;
+
+       return !(state == pd->ops->device_get_power_state(pd->domain));
+}
+
+static int scpi_pd_power_on(struct generic_pm_domain *domain)
+{
+       struct scpi_pm_domain *pd = to_scpi_pd(domain);
+
+       return scpi_pd_power(pd, true);
+}
+
+static int scpi_pd_power_off(struct generic_pm_domain *domain)
+{
+       struct scpi_pm_domain *pd = to_scpi_pd(domain);
+
+       return scpi_pd_power(pd, false);
+}
+
+static int scpi_pm_domain_probe(struct platform_device *pdev)
+{
+       struct device *dev = &pdev->dev;
+       struct device_node *np = dev->of_node;
+       struct scpi_pm_domain *scpi_pd;
+       struct genpd_onecell_data *scpi_pd_data;
+       struct generic_pm_domain **domains;
+       struct scpi_ops *scpi_ops;
+       int ret, num_domains, i;
+
+       scpi_ops = get_scpi_ops();
+       if (!scpi_ops)
+               return -EPROBE_DEFER;
+
+       if (!np) {
+               dev_err(dev, "device tree node not found\n");
+               return -ENODEV;
+       }
+
+       if (!scpi_ops->device_set_power_state ||
+           !scpi_ops->device_get_power_state) {
+               dev_err(dev, "power domains not supported in the firmware\n");
+               return -ENODEV;
+       }
+
+       ret = of_property_read_u32(np, "num-domains", &num_domains);
+       if (ret) {
+               dev_err(dev, "number of domains not found\n");
+               return -EINVAL;
+       }
+
+       scpi_pd = devm_kcalloc(dev, num_domains, sizeof(*scpi_pd), GFP_KERNEL);
+       if (!scpi_pd)
+               return -ENOMEM;
+
+       scpi_pd_data = devm_kzalloc(dev, sizeof(*scpi_pd_data), GFP_KERNEL);
+       if (!scpi_pd_data)
+               return -ENOMEM;
+
+       domains = devm_kcalloc(dev, num_domains, sizeof(*domains), GFP_KERNEL);
+       if (!domains)
+               return -ENOMEM;
+
+       for (i = 0; i < num_domains; i++, scpi_pd++) {
+               domains[i] = &scpi_pd->genpd;
+
+               scpi_pd->domain = i;
+               scpi_pd->ops = scpi_ops;
+               sprintf(scpi_pd->name, "%s.%d", np->name, i);
+               scpi_pd->genpd.name = scpi_pd->name;
+               scpi_pd->genpd.power_off = scpi_pd_power_off;
+               scpi_pd->genpd.power_on = scpi_pd_power_on;
+
+               /*
+                * Treat all power domains as off at boot.
+                *
+                * The SCP firmware itself may have switched on some domains,
+                * but for reference counting purpose, keep it this way.
+                */
+               pm_genpd_init(&scpi_pd->genpd, NULL, true);
+       }
+
+       scpi_pd_data->domains = domains;
+       scpi_pd_data->num_domains = num_domains;
+
+       of_genpd_add_provider_onecell(np, scpi_pd_data);
+
+       return 0;
+}
+
+static const struct of_device_id scpi_power_domain_ids[] = {
+       { .compatible = "arm,scpi-power-domains", },
+       { /* sentinel */ }
+};
+MODULE_DEVICE_TABLE(of, scpi_power_domain_ids);
+
+static struct platform_driver scpi_power_domain_driver = {
+       .driver = {
+               .name = "scpi_power_domain",
+               .of_match_table = scpi_power_domain_ids,
+       },
+       .probe = scpi_pm_domain_probe,
+};
+module_platform_driver(scpi_power_domain_driver);
+
+MODULE_AUTHOR("Sudeep Holla <sudeep.holla@arm.com>");
+MODULE_DESCRIPTION("ARM SCPI power domain driver");
+MODULE_LICENSE("GPL v2");
